The problem

The data existed. The tool didn't.

More time gets spent assembling data than evaluating sites. And when someone asks why one location scored higher than another, the answer is "trust the model." Nobody can defend the recommendation because nobody can trace where the numbers came from.

Mapquery replaces the entire toolkit. Search any area, run AI research on any location, and walk into the room with a clear answer you can actually explain.
